## Deployment — Taxgrid Cache. Taxgrid caches jurisdiction tax rates pulled from the Ledgermark upstream. Deploys are blue-green; the cache warms from a snapshot before traffic shifts, so cold-start misses stay under 1%. Never deploy during the quarterly rate refresh window. Invalidation runs nightly; manual flushes need a ticket. The warm-up and TTL behavior is controlled entirely by the values below:

config for bahop-fajep:
DRUATH_PIN=4501
DRUATH_TENANT=briwyn
DRUATH_METRICS_HOST=metrics.druath.brasksoft.test
DRUATH_SEAL=seal_7d2e069d
DRUATH_STANDBY_TEAM=olieth

Subject: Key rotation for InvoiceForge renderer

Welcome, new folks. Every quarter we rotate the credential the Pellworth PDF invoice renderer uses to call our internal asset service, Vaultline. The old key stops working Friday at noon. Update your local .env and the staging config before then, and verify a test invoice renders with the new embedded fonts. For convenience, the freshly issued key is included here.

app token of bagef-bageg = kto11_vuwA0uhrEMg

Subject: RenderFast cut-over complete

Hi all — the cut-over to the RenderFast template engine finished last night. Median render time on the Quillbase storefront dropped from 180ms to 40ms, and cache hit rates look healthy. Old engine stays dark for two weeks as a fallback. New joiners: the production settings are shown here.

settings of tagef-bawif:
DRUIX_HOST=druix.zemvarlabs.internal
DRUIX_PORT=8000

Subject: Quickstore 4.2 — bloom filter now fronts the KV layer

Plugin authors: starting with this release, Quickstore places a bloom filter ahead of the key-value store. Negative lookups return faster; false positives fall through safely. No API changes are required on your side. Verify your plugin against the staging build referenced below.

session token of fahif-tadup = htk3_9c7